Output ba6108db761a2fb08d6ed5dff1dced8325043cde65843780629ae50f84c5713a:1

value
2628945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c163acf7cb0eddf74b456a2ebd296205d8e1383 OP_EQUAL
address
3D18LsxMRPJ6MKfZUYymZ4mtgCKn3FZD2o
transaction
ba6108db761a2fb08d6ed5dff1dced8325043cde65843780629ae50f84c5713a
spent
true